On average across the year,
no, Yukon, Canada is not hotter than
Corunna, Ontario
.
Yukon, Canada has an average temperature of -1°C/30°F and Corunna, Ontario has an average temperature of 10°C/50°F.
Yukon, Canada's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 21°C/70°F, which is not hotter than Corunna, Ontario's hottest month (also July, with an average maximum temperature of 28°C/82°F).
On average across the year, yes, Yukon, Canada is colder than Corunna, Ontario . Yukon, Canada has an average minimum temperature of -7°C/19°F and Corunna, Ontario has an average minimum temperature of 5°C/41°F.
On average across the year,
no, Yukon, Canada has less rain than
Corunna, Ontario. Yukon, Canada has an average annual rainfall of 203mm and Corunna, Ontario has an average annual rainfall of 1062mm.
Yukon, Canada's wettest month is July, with an average monthly rainfall of 35mm, which is drier than Corunna, Ontario's wettest month (August, with an average monthly rainfall of 130mm).
